i believe that would boost your compression to 10.8. obviously way too high for a turbo setup if you're still going to do that, but not bad if you are just driving around on those till you get a set of 5.7L heads. Going with 5.3L heads on a 5.7 block is sortof a trade off if you keep them stock though. You get added compression, but it comes at the price of the smaller valves <img border="0" title="" alt="[Frown]" src="gr_sad.gif" />
